Katy council approves overlay of pickleball lines on two Katy City Park courts, asks for community input
The Katy City Council on June 12 authorized a proposal from McKenna Contracting Inc. to overlay pickleball lines on tennis courts 5 and 6 at Katy City Park, 5720 Franz Road, using Region 5 ESC purchasing cooperative contract #20250908.

Staff said the recommendation was to stripe two courts initially and return later if demand requires additional overlay; the agenda memo listed a fiscal impact of $1,200–$2,400 depending on whether additional courts are added. Council members asked staff to make sure tennis and pickleball players have input on the design and to check line colors and contrast (staff suggested blue or yellow lines over white tennis lines). Council approved the motion to proceed with two courts by voice vote.

Parks staff will coordinate with local players on line color and placement before any additional striping is performed, and a follow-up to report completion was discussed as an administrative task.
